Abstract
The principal aim of foetal monitoring during labor is early detection of hypoxia. Current methods are unable to accomplish this task. Pulse oximetry permits continuous measurement of oxygen saturation and is the best method to detect early hypoxia. In this report, an optical scalp electrode is presented, which permits continuous monitoring of foetal oxygen saturation during labor.Entities:
